Overview
Grondona is a charming small village set in the green hills of Piedmont, Italy, with a rich medieval heritage and tranquil rural setting. The town offers a glimpse into authentic Italian countryside life, surrounded by forests and mountain views. Visitors can enjoy peaceful walks, local cuisine, and the friendly atmosphere typical of northern Italian villages.
